package android.media.audiopolicy;

import android.annotation.NonNull;
import android.annotation.Nullable;
import android.annotation.SystemApi;
import android.annotation.TestApi;
import android.media.AudioAttributes;
import android.media.AudioSystem;
import android.os.Parcel;
import android.os.Parcelable;
import android.text.TextUtils;
import android.util.Log;

import com.android.internal.annotations.GuardedBy;

import java.util.ArrayList;
import java.util.Arrays;
import java.util.List;
import java.util.Objects;

/**
 * @hide
 * A class to encapsulate a collection of attributes associated to a given product strategy
 * (and for legacy reason, keep the association with the stream type).
 */
@SystemApi
public final class AudioProductStrategy implements Parcelable {
    /**
     * group value to use when introspection API fails.
     * @hide
     */
    public static final int DEFAULT_GROUP = -1;


    private static final String TAG = "AudioProductStrategy";

    /**
     * The audio flags that will affect product strategy selection.
     */
    private static final int AUDIO_FLAGS_AFFECT_STRATEGY_SELECTION =
            AudioAttributes.FLAG_AUDIBILITY_ENFORCED
                    | AudioAttributes.FLAG_SCO
                    | AudioAttributes.FLAG_BEACON;

    private final AudioAttributesGroup[] mAudioAttributesGroups;
    private final String mName;
    /**
     * Unique identifier of a product strategy.
     * This Id can be assimilated to Car Audio Usage and even more generally to usage.
     * For legacy platforms, the product strategy id is the routing_strategy, which was hidden to
     * upper layer but was transpiring in the {@link AudioAttributes#getUsage()}.
     */
    private int mId;

    private static final Object sLock = new Object();

    @GuardedBy("sLock")
    private static List<AudioProductStrategy> sAudioProductStrategies;

    /**
     * @hide
     * @return the list of AudioProductStrategy discovered from platform configuration file.
     */
    @NonNull
    public static List<AudioProductStrategy> getAudioProductStrategies() {
        if (sAudioProductStrategies == null) {
            synchronized (sLock) {
                if (sAudioProductStrategies == null) {
                    sAudioProductStrategies = initializeAudioProductStrategies();
                }
            }
        }
        return sAudioProductStrategies;
    }

    /**
     * @hide
     * Return the AudioProductStrategy object for the given strategy ID.
     * @param id the ID of the strategy to find
     * @return an AudioProductStrategy on which getId() would return id, null if no such strategy
     *     exists.
     */
    public static @Nullable AudioProductStrategy getAudioProductStrategyWithId(int id) {
        synchronized (sLock) {
            if (sAudioProductStrategies == null) {
                sAudioProductStrategies = initializeAudioProductStrategies();
            }
            for (AudioProductStrategy strategy : sAudioProductStrategies) {
                if (strategy.getId() == id) {
                    return strategy;
                }
            }
        }
        return null;
    }

    /**
     * @hide
     * Create an invalid AudioProductStrategy instance for testing
     * @param id the ID for the invalid strategy, always use a different one than in use
     * @return an invalid instance that cannot successfully be used for volume groups or routing
     */
    @SystemApi
    public static @NonNull AudioProductStrategy createInvalidAudioProductStrategy(int id) {
        return new AudioProductStrategy("dummy strategy", id, new AudioAttributesGroup[0]);
    }

    /**
     * @hide
     * @param streamType to match against AudioProductStrategy
     * @return the AudioAttributes for the first strategy found with the associated stream type
     *          If no match is found, returns AudioAttributes with unknown content_type and usage
     */
    @NonNull
    public static AudioAttributes getAudioAttributesForStrategyWithLegacyStreamType(
            int streamType) {
        for (final AudioProductStrategy productStrategy :
                AudioProductStrategy.getAudioProductStrategies()) {
            AudioAttributes aa = productStrategy.getAudioAttributesForLegacyStreamType(streamType);
            if (aa != null) {
                return aa;
            }
        }
        return DEFAULT_ATTRIBUTES;
    }

    /**
     * @hide
     * @param audioAttributes to identify {@link AudioProductStrategy} with
     * @return legacy stream type associated with matched {@link AudioProductStrategy}. If no
     *              strategy found or found {@link AudioProductStrategy} does not have associated
     *              legacy stream (i.e. associated with {@link AudioSystem#STREAM_DEFAULT}) defaults
     *              to {@link AudioSystem#STREAM_MUSIC}
     */
    public static int getLegacyStreamTypeForStrategyWithAudioAttributes(
            @NonNull AudioAttributes audioAttributes) {
        Objects.requireNonNull(audioAttributes, "AudioAttributes must not be null");
        for (final AudioProductStrategy productStrategy :
                AudioProductStrategy.getAudioProductStrategies()) {
            if (productStrategy.supportsAudioAttributes(audioAttributes)) {
                int streamType = productStrategy.getLegacyStreamTypeForAudioAttributes(
                        audioAttributes);
                if (streamType == AudioSystem.STREAM_DEFAULT) {
                    Log.w(TAG, "Attributes " + audioAttributes + " supported by strategy "
                            + productStrategy.getId() + " have no associated stream type, "
                            + "therefore falling back to STREAM_MUSIC");
                    return AudioSystem.STREAM_MUSIC;
                }
                if (streamType < AudioSystem.getNumStreamTypes()) {
                    return streamType;
                }
            }
        }
        return AudioSystem.STREAM_MUSIC;
    }

    /**
     * @hide
     * @param attributes the {@link AudioAttributes} to identify VolumeGroupId with
     * @param fallbackOnDefault if set, allows to fallback on the default group (e.g. the group
     *                          associated to {@link AudioManager#STREAM_MUSIC}).
     * @return volume group id associated with the given {@link AudioAttributes} if found,
     *     default volume group id if fallbackOnDefault is set
     * <p>By convention, the product strategy with default attributes will be associated to the
     * default volume group (e.g. associated to {@link AudioManager#STREAM_MUSIC})
     * or {@link AudioVolumeGroup#DEFAULT_VOLUME_GROUP} if not found.
     */
    public static int getVolumeGroupIdForAudioAttributes(
            @NonNull AudioAttributes attributes, boolean fallbackOnDefault) {
        Objects.requireNonNull(attributes, "attributes must not be null");
        int volumeGroupId = getVolumeGroupIdForAudioAttributesInt(attributes);
        if (volumeGroupId != AudioVolumeGroup.DEFAULT_VOLUME_GROUP) {
            return volumeGroupId;
        }
        if (fallbackOnDefault) {
            return getVolumeGroupIdForAudioAttributesInt(getDefaultAttributes());
        }
        return AudioVolumeGroup.DEFAULT_VOLUME_GROUP;
    }

    /**
     * @hide
     * Default attributes, with default source to be aligned with native.
     */
    private static final @NonNull AudioAttributes DEFAULT_ATTRIBUTES =
            new AudioAttributes.Builder().build();

    /**
     * @hide
     */
    @TestApi
    public static @NonNull AudioAttributes getDefaultAttributes() {
        return DEFAULT_ATTRIBUTES;
    }

    /**
     * To avoid duplicating the logic in java and native, we shall make use of
     * native API native_get_product_strategies_from_audio_attributes
     * Keep in sync with frameworks/av/media/libaudioclient/AudioProductStrategy::attributesMatches
     * @param refAttr {@link AudioAttributes} to be taken as the reference
     * @param attr {@link AudioAttributes} of the requester.
     */
    private static boolean attributesMatches(@NonNull AudioAttributes refAttr,
            @NonNull AudioAttributes attr) {
        Objects.requireNonNull(refAttr, "reference AudioAttributes must not be null");
        Objects.requireNonNull(attr, "requester's AudioAttributes must not be null");
        String refFormattedTags = TextUtils.join(";", refAttr.getTags());
        String cliFormattedTags = TextUtils.join(";", attr.getTags());
        if (refAttr.equals(DEFAULT_ATTRIBUTES)) {
            return false;
        }
        return ((refAttr.getSystemUsage() == AudioAttributes.USAGE_UNKNOWN)
                || (attr.getSystemUsage() == refAttr.getSystemUsage()))
            && ((refAttr.getContentType() == AudioAttributes.CONTENT_TYPE_UNKNOWN)
                || (attr.getContentType() == refAttr.getContentType()))
            && (((refAttr.getAllFlags() & AUDIO_FLAGS_AFFECT_STRATEGY_SELECTION) == 0)
                || ((attr.getAllFlags() & AUDIO_FLAGS_AFFECT_STRATEGY_SELECTION) != 0
                && (attr.getAllFlags() & refAttr.getAllFlags()) == refAttr.getAllFlags()))
            && ((refFormattedTags.length() == 0) || refFormattedTags.equals(cliFormattedTags));
    }
